Output 31efd4b003e9e1e783d55d18f7dfbbeb4ef1f97a0763b15bc7def96ce35abada:1

value
26870776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f012fae533cab77a853b55825394b5befb9fdb2 OP_EQUAL
address
MKUhUDRXwVyTktrpAkRzqjPEjf8KtymycC
transaction
31efd4b003e9e1e783d55d18f7dfbbeb4ef1f97a0763b15bc7def96ce35abada
spent
true